Now to NFL Notes

Favorites covered 10 games this weekend, while the underdogs got the money in 6 games. Double digit dogs were 3-0. Three dogs out of the 6 underdogs won their game s/u.

Over and Unders also went 10-6 with the Overs being the 10. In games with a total of 37.5 or less the Overs went 5-1.

Texans-Qb Matt Schaub is not playing with the same confidence as last season. It doesn't help that the OL is having problems blocking and WR Andre Johnson had 3 drops in the first half.

Titans- Right now the Titans are playing the best football in the AFC. The Titans didn't even want QB Vince Young on the sidelines Sunday and put him up in the press box.

Raiders/Cardinals-Both west coast teams playing early games on the East Coast were 1-1 ATS. Cards started slow, while the Raiders started fast.

Cardinals-Stayed this week in Virginia to practice and will take the bus up to the Meadowlands this weekend for the Jet game.(check weather )

Bears-QB Kyle Orten hadn't thrown a int this season, but the Bucs got 2 on Sunday.

Tampa Bay- What's up with back up QB Greise throwing 60+ times in game.

Rams-QB Trent Green will replace QB Bulger. He can't play any worse than Bulger?

Bengals-By watching Head Coach Marvin Lewis demeanor, frustration, and facial expressions, you can tell he needs a win real fast to keep his job.

Steelers-Offensive Line was dominated by the Eagles defense. QB Big Ben took a beating.

Saints-Defense is terrible, cluster injuries on offense.
